More and more traditional professional services firms are turning to "productization" as a strategy to grow, improve valuations, and to fend off new digital-first competitors.   However, many of them will fail and waste a lot of money in the process.  Productize first outlines the "Seven Deadly Productization Mistakes" made when pursuing a product strategy, then provides the blueprint for overcoming each of these missteps. It is designed to be a practical playbook for any leader of a professional services business who wants to successfully accelerate growth. For companies that deliver highly customized services, new product development and commercialization are often outside of their core skills, processes, and mindsets. Productizing services typically requires organizations to think differently about how they work and how they create value for their customers. This change does not come easily. Productize includes real-life case studies and stories featuring professional services leaders who have successfully led their organizations to create more scalable services and products. It also includes more than two dozen tools and templates to help your team implement the tactics so you don't have to start from scratch. In this book, you'll learn:•    How to turn shift your culture to embrace a product-mindset•    The capabilities you to be successful and whether or not you should acquire them or grow them internally•    How much money to invest in exploring and building more scalable solutions and products•    How to ensure there is a viable market for your product idea•    How to sequence investments in new product development•    How to successfully source and work with developers and data scientists•    How to inexpensively test your ideas before investing in development•    How to win the hearts and minds of your sales team to ensure your new products are commercially successful•    Bonus: Key point summaries at the end of each chapter to help you lock in what you learn•    Real Life Case Studies: featuring professional services leaders who have successfully led their organizations to create more scalable services and productsProductize draws on the 25+ years of experience that Eisha Armstrong has in successfully creating, launching and growing productized services. Eisha knows what works and what doesn't and she is passionate about making sure organizations learn from each other and avoid reinventing the wheel.
